FSSAI Launches Food Safety Compliance System (FoSCoS)- Platform For Food Safety Compliance   In the FSSAI regulations, there are two categories of food products —standardized and non- standardized. The standardized food products are those food items for which standards are prescribed and do not require product approval before manufacture, distribution, sale, or import in India. […]
